Northern Illinois 38, Arkansas State 20
When: 9:00 PM ET, Sunday, January 8, 2012
Where: Ladd-Peebles Stadium, Mobile, Alabama
Temperature: 64°
Head Official: Tom McCreesh
Attendance: 38734

Senior quarterback Chandler Harnish completed his record-setting career by throwing for 270 yards and two touchdowns to lead Northern Illinois to a 38-20 win over Arkansas State in the Go Daddy.com Bowl in Mobile, Ala.

Harnish, voted the Most Outstanding Player in the Mid-American Conference after leading the Huskies to the conference title, completed 18 of 36 passes and became the school’s first player to pass for more than 3,000 yards in a season. Harnish threw scoring passes of 9 yards to Perez Ashford and 43 yards to Martel Moore. Ashford had seven catches for 74 yards, while Moore exploded for eight catches for 223 yards.

Northern Illinois (11-3) also scored on a 3-yard run by Jordan Lynch and 1-yard run by Jamal Womble. Mathew Sims added a 22-yard field goal.

Arkansas State (10-3) was unable to hold a 13-0 first-quarter lead thanks largely to five turnovers. The Red Wolves, who had a nine-game winning streak broken, got field goals of 33 and 36 yards from Brian Davis, a 2-yard touchdown run by quarterback Ryan Aplin, and a 17-yard scoring pass from Aplin to Taylor Stockemer.

Aplin, the Sun Belt Conference’s Offensive Player of the Year, completed 30 of 58 passes for 351 yards, but was intercepted three times. The last pick was returned by Dechane Durante for a 36-yard touchdown.
